This is the moment Channel 4 presenter Krishnan Guru-Murthy stopped a news report on the Greek island of Lesbos to help refugees climb ashore.

As the controversial presenter and news reporter halted his report, which was detailing the journey refugees are making from the Middle East, he lent a hand to both adults and children climbing ashore from a rubber dinghy.

The boat had reportedly travelled six kilometres from the Turkish coast, and the task of climbing over the slippery rocks looked a challenge for the children and elderly among the group.

The scenes are a world apart from what happened in Hungary the other night, when a Hungarian camerawoman for a news channel was caught on film tripping up and kicking fleeing refugees.
